Materials: Oxford, Tarpaulin or PVC?

Selection of material transporter It's a trade-off between weight, strength and cost, and the most common option for the budget and mid-range segment is fabric. Oxford with polyurethane (PU) or polyvinyl chloride (PVC) coatings, the density of the fabric should be at least 400-600 g/m2. Less dense materials risk not to withstand dynamic loads at speeds above 80 km/h.

A more expensive, but also much more reliable solution is reinforced PVC materialThese awnings are completely waterproof, are not afraid of ultraviolet light and have high tensile strength. However, their weight is significantly higher, which is important to consider when calculating the payload of a trailer. PVC also requires more careful storage to avoid crumbs in the cold.

⚠️ Attention: Do not use conventional plastic film or low-quality construction tarpaulin to create homemade awnings. At 90-100 km / h, such materials break instantly, and their scraps can wind on the wheels of the trailer or close the driver's view, creating an emergency situation.

The third option is specialized Teflon-impregnated membrane fabrics, which have excellent water-repellent properties and allow the condensate to evaporate from the inside, preventing mold formation. For owners who keep the boat outside between trips, this can be a critical factor, although this is redundant for a purely transport function.

Fixing systems and sail protection

The reliability of the awning fixation depends on the quality of the fittings used. Cheap plastic clips or weak rubber bands are categorically not suitable for high-speed transportation. fastex And a strong cord that runs around the perimeter of the awning through the luvers, and the cord must be tightened by a special rattle or tension mechanism.

For the model Volzhanka 46 It's characterized by open sides and decks, so the awning is often fixed for special bolts or factory holes in the shaft. If there are not enough regular mounting points, owners install additional rivets or use clamping slats. The main rule is that no part of the awning should hang out in the wind.

Special attention should be paid to the bow, and that's where the high-pressure zone comes in, where the mounting should be as rigid as possible, and often an additional central sling running along the diametric plane of the boat, locking the awning in the area. pole-headPreventing it from sliding backwards when the car is braking sharply.

Tent care and storage

Even the most durable. transporter After every trip, especially if it's in the rain or on dirty roads, the cover needs to be removed, dried and dusted, and the dirt that gets into the fabric works like an abrasive, breaking down the fibers at every addition.

Use warm water and soft soap to clean, aggressive chemicals, solvents or hard brushes are prohibited because they can damage the water-repellent impregnation, and the awning should be dried in the shade, avoiding direct sunlight, which, if exposed for long periods, accelerates the aging of synthetic fibers.

⚠️ Attention: Never store a wet or wet awning. When rolled up in a moist environment, the process of rotting threads and mold immediately begins, which irreversibly reduces the strength of the material. If you can not dry, store the cover in an unstretched form until completely dry.

Store the product in a dry, ventilated room, away from heating appliances and open flames, optimally fold the awning in a special bag, which often comes with a package, or hang on a wide bar, Proper storage will extend the life of the accessory for several seasons.

FAQ: Frequently asked questions

Can I use a parking awning for transportation at speed?

Parking awnings do not have a reinforced cut, sufficient tissue density and a fastening system capable of withstanding wind loads on the track, and their use when driving can lead to tissue rupture and damage to the boat.

Do I need to remove the awning during long parking?

If the parking is longer than a day, the transport awning is better to remove or ease tension. prolonged exposure to severe tension can lead to deformation of the seams and loss of tissue elasticity.

What is the maximum speed with a stretched awning?

For high-quality specialized awnings from Oxford 600D and above, speeds up to 110 km / h are considered safe. However, it is recommended not to exceed the speed mode of 90 km / h to minimize the risk of damage to the cargo and reduce fuel consumption of the car due to increased aerodynamic drag.

Can I repair a broken awning on my own?

Small cuts and punctures can be sealed with special PVC remixes or tissue patches with glue. However, if the bearing seams are damaged or the gap exceeds 10-15 cm, it is better to contact the workshop or replace the product, since the integrity of the structure has already been broken.
